How they compare

Papua New Guinea currently reports 0.1717 against 0.1712 in Bangladesh, a difference of 0.0005.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 8 shared years of data; in 1940 it was Bangladesh ahead.

Bangladesh ranks 148th and Papua New Guinea ranks 147th of 190 countries.

Across the 8 decades both report, Bangladesh averaged higher in 6 and Papua New Guinea in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bangladesh Papua New Guinea Difference Ahead
1940s -0.5911 -1.16 0.5734 Bangladesh
1950s -0.4836 -0.7081 0.2246 Bangladesh
1960s -0.3918 -0.9582 0.5664 Bangladesh
1970s -0.4097 -0.6941 0.2844 Bangladesh
1980s -0.3146 -0.3821 0.0675 Bangladesh
1990s -0.241 -0.2037 0.0373 Papua New Guinea
2000s 0.0246 -0.0442 0.0687 Bangladesh
2010s 0.1712 0.1717 0.0005 Papua New Guinea

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
